Motorola Moto G Stylus 4G 2022 Microphone Repair
Microphone Repair guide for the Motorola Moto G Stylus 4G 2022
Before you begin
Tools
- Phillips #00 Screwdriver
- Heat Gun or iOpener
- Suction Cup
- Opening Picks
- Spudger
- Precision Tweezers
- SIM Eject Tool
Parts / materials
- Replacement Daughterboard with Microphone
- Back Cover Adhesive Strips
- 99% Isopropyl Alcohol
Safety
- Power off the phone completely before starting any disassembly steps.
- Wear safety glasses to protect your eyes from heat and glass debris.
- Take care not to puncture or bend the internal battery with metal tools.

Step-by-step
- 1
Remove the Stylus
1 minPress the stylus spring button at the bottom of the phone to eject it, then pull it completely out.
- 2
Eject the SIM Tray
1 minInsert a SIM eject tool into the hole on the left edge of the phone to pop out the SIM tray.
- 3
Heat the Back Cover
2 minApply a heated iOpener or heat gun to the rear glass perimeter for two minutes to soften the adhesive.
- 4
Attach a Suction Cup
1 minPlace a suction cup near the bottom edge of the back panel and pull upward to create a small gap.
- 5
Insert an Opening Pick
1 minSlide a thin opening pick into the gap created beneath the rear panel.
- 6
Slice the Adhesive Perimeter
3 minSlide the pick carefully around all four edges of the back cover to cut through the perimeter glue.
- 7
Lift Off the Back Cover
1 minSeparate the back cover from the phone chassis and set it aside.
- 8
Unscrew Lower Loudspeaker Housing
2 minRemove the Phillips #00 screws securing the plastic lower speaker cover to the frame.
- 9
Pry Up Speaker Assembly
1 minInsert a spudger under the notch of the loudspeaker housing and pop it out from the bottom frame.
- 10
Disconnect Interconnect Flex Cable
1 minUse the flat end of a spudger to pry the main display/board interconnect flex cable straight up from the daughterboard.
- 11
Disconnect Coaxial Antenna Cable
1 minUse fine tweezers to gently lift the antenna cable head straight off its snap connector on the daughterboard.
- 12
Remove Old Daughterboard
2 minPry the sub-board containing the integrated primary microphone up out of the lower chassis cavity.
- 13
Install New Daughterboard
1 minPosition the new daughterboard with microphone into the bottom frame slot and press it down gently.
- 14
Attach Antenna and Flex Cables
2 minSnap the coaxial antenna cable and main interconnect flex cable onto their respective daughterboard connectors.
- 15
Reinstall Loudspeaker Assembly
1 minSet the lower speaker housing over the daughterboard and press down until it snaps in place.
- 16
Secure Loudspeaker Screws
2 minReinstall and tighten the Phillips #00 screws into the loudspeaker cover.
- 17
Apply New Back Cover Adhesive
3 minClean remaining glue with isopropyl alcohol and apply pre-cut adhesive strips along the frame perimeter.
- 18
Seal Back Cover and Reinsert Tray
2 minAlign the back cover, press firmly around the edges to seal, and reinsert the SIM tray and stylus.
After your Motorola Moto G Stylus 4G 2022 microphone repair
Power the Moto G Stylus 4G 2022 back on and test the microphone repair function before you put every screw away. Check touch/display response, charging, cameras, buttons, and wireless as relevant to this repair. If something fails after closing the device, reopen carefully and reseat the connectors for this Motorola Moto G Stylus 4G 2022 job before assuming the part is defective. Keep leftover adhesive and screws labeled in case you need a second pass.
